Same here -- I've been thinking of altering the colors a bit though. It seems too... White? I've been contemplating either changing the white to maybe a slate grey, or switching the black and white, so that it'd be more black with white trims. I've also been doodling my own GLaDOS designs but I haven't found one I'm confident with yet.

My brother's doing a Pyro (Team Fortress 2)cosplay and brought up the idea of cosplaying other Orange Box characters. He asked how I'd do GlaDos or what I think a humanoid GlaD would look like.
I said a female Scientist cyborg thing ^^. White lab coat, smart trousers/skirt. Then wires, buttons and scanners ( like mini versions of her cameras) here and there . As for her spheres; maybe on a necklace or other jewelery. I saw a picture of a Companion Cube cosplay on 4chan last night with the caption " you have to think outside the box" next to it. |

My Companion Cube didn't get finished in time. It's currently a large cardboard cube (20" per side) covered in fiberglass resin. I made up blueprints for the corners and middle sections, but there wasn't time.
The Portal Gun was Plan B. When that almost didn't get finished either, the Cake became Plan C. ![]() I entered the costume contest and sang the first verse of "Still Alive" - wondering if anyone recorded it?
